Question

Assertion (A): A non conservative force (F) can be given by the relation F=−dudx
Reason (R) : Work done by the conservative force is independent of the path followed

Solution

The correct option is D A is false and R is true
The work done by a non-conservative force does depend upon the path taken. For example when we pull an object on a rough surface the pull depends on the surface or in other words the friction. The path determines the force with the object is pulled.
But t
he work done by a conservative force does not depend upon the path taken. For example, gravity acting on a body does not depend on the path.
Hence, Assertion (A): Wrong
Reason (R) :Correct
